If your SD card is formatted FAT32 then the maximum size of a file which can be saved is 4GB and a movie bigger than 4GB does not fit.
And above is your problem.

To solve it you have to format your SD card to exFAT. See below how to do it

Note: Formatting erases all data currently stored on the SD card. We strongly recommend that you backup all data on the card before performing these steps.

1.Insert the SD card into the PC
2.Open My Computer and right-click on the drive named Removable Disk (if you have multiple removable disks then check the capacity of the disk by selecting Properties)
3.Click Format.
4.In the 'File System' dropdown, choose exFAT
5.In the 'Allocation unit size' dropdown, choose Default allocation size
6.Click Start and close this window when finished.
7.Your SD card is now using the exFAT file system.
